"""
Scripts to manage categories.

Syntax: python category.py action [-option]

where action can be one of these:
 * add      - mass-add a category to a list of pages
 * remove   - remove category tag from all pages in a category
 * move     - move all pages in a category to another category
 * tidy     - tidy up a category by moving its articles into subcategories
 * tree     - show a tree of subcategories of a given category
 * listify  - make a list of all of the articles that are in a category

and option can be one of these:
 * -person     - sort persons by their last name (for action 'add')
 * -rebuild    - reset the database
 * -from:      - The category to move from (for the move option)
                 Also, the category to remove from in the remove option
                 Also, the category to make a list of in the listify option
 * -to:        - The category to move to (for the move option)
               - Also, the name of the list to make in the listify option
         NOTE: If the category names have spaces in them you may need to use a
         special syntax in your shell so that the names aren't treated as separate
         parameters.  For instance, in BASH, use single quotes, e.g. -from:'Polar bears'
 * -batch      - Don't prompt to delete emptied categories (do it automatically).
 * -summary:   - Pick a custom edit summary for the bot.
 * -inplace    - Use this flag to change categories in place rather than
                 rearranging them.
 * -delsum     - An option for remove, this specifies to use the custom edit
                 summary as the deletion reason (rather than a canned deletion reason)
 * -overwrite  - An option for listify, this overwrites the current page with the
                 list even if something is already there.
 * -showimages - An option for listify, this displays images rather than linking them
                 in the list.
 * -talkpages  - An option for listify, this outputs the links to talk pages of the
                 pages to be listified in addition to the pages themselves.
 * -recurse    - Recurse through all subcategories of categories.
 * -match      - Only work on pages whose titles match the given regex (for move and remove actions).


For the actions tidy and tree, the bot will store the category structure locally
in category.dump. This saves time and server load, but if it uses these data
later, they may be outdated; use the -rebuild parameter in this case.

For example, to create a new category from a list of persons, type:

  python category.py add -person

and follow the on-screen instructions.


Or to do it all from the command-line, use the following syntax:

  python category.py move -from:US -to:'United States'

This will move all pages in the category US to the category United States.

"""

class CategoryTidyRobot:
    """
    Script to help a human to tidy up a category by moving its articles into
    subcategories

    Specify the category name on the command line. The program will pick up the
    page, and look for all subcategories and supercategories, and show them with
    a number adjacent to them. It will then automatically loop over all pages
    in the category. It will ask you to type the number of the appropriate
    replacement, and perform the change robotically.

    If you don't want to move the article to a subcategory or supercategory, but to
    another category, you can use the 'j' (jump) command.

    Typing 's' will leave the complete page unchanged.

    Typing '?' will show you the first few bytes of the current page, helping
    you to find out what the article is about and in which other categories it
    currently is.

    Important:
     * this bot is written to work with the MonoBook skin, so make sure your bot
       account uses this skin
    """
